Morocco Surpasses 3,000 COVID-19 Recoveries as New Cases Slow
Morocco now has more than 3,000 recovered cases, with the recording of 108 new recoveries overnight from Tuesday to Wednesday. An update from the website dedicated to covid-19 indicates that no deaths have been recorded since May 11.
More than two months after the discovery of the first case of covid-19, the new report shows 6,466 confirmed cases, including 48 new infections since last night, 67,742 cases excluded after negative laboratory tests, and 3,179 cases under treatment.
The 48 new cases are concentrated in 6 regions. Casablanca-Settat is in the lead with 1,780 cases (+28), followed by Marrakech-Safi, with 1,221 cases (+8), Fès-Meknès with 906 cases (+7), Tanger-Tétouan-Al Hoceïma with 921 cases (+3), Rabat-Salé-Kénitra with 651 cases (+3) and the Oriental with 176 cases (+3).
As usual, the ministry calls on Moroccans to respect the rules of hygiene and health safety as well as the preventive measures taken by the Moroccan authorities by showing responsibility.
